Transaction 72876d99fda95ad404b2efbb3abdfd6996206fb6f10a20620de754967e016124

2 Input
2 Outputs
  • 72876d99fda95ad404b2efbb3abdfd6996206fb6f10a20620de754967e016124:0
  • value  435407
    address  3EkpzsrvNDNuhRi7xnjZEet1PGMmxT9Vwj
  • 72876d99fda95ad404b2efbb3abdfd6996206fb6f10a20620de754967e016124:1
  • value  38754
    address  1FUqsSu3eRgzSS7MpNvagZrhiPvfkHABy9